Untapped Potential Markets Lie in Developing Countries Whether it is through the deserts of Africa or over the landmass of China, many developing nations have insufficient resources to install communications cable networks. With these countries lacking plain old telephone service (POTS), cellular telephones are becoming a vital necessity, and providers are desperate for equipment to fulfill demand. "Countries abroad do not have the cable/fiber infrastructure that the U.S. has and are therefore much more receptive to wireless technology," says the author. As a result, wireless equipment becomes doubly attractive to these nations since maintenance costs are far less than land-based systems.
